TWO DECADES OF COUNTRY MUSIC!
Carved out of friendship and passion for country music, Western Bred hit the Arizona music scene in the early 1980's. Blending strong vocals with high energy music and a commitment to entertain, Western Bred quickly became a favorite in Phoenix area honky tonks and dance clubs. In 1989, legendary Phoenix night club (Mr. Lucky's) hired Western Bred as the house band. This spawned an opportunity to share the stage with local country music icon, and club owner J David Sloan. Together they would spend the next fourteen years entertaining folks from the stage of Arizona's ..1 country music night club, performing 5 nights a week, along with a strict rehearsal schedule; this would prove to be a great platform to mold the band into a craftful music force. This venue would also bring the opportunity to work shows with recording artists such as Kenny Chesney, Mark Chestnut, Dixie Chicks, Keith Urban, Waylon Jennings, and many more. With the heightened popularity and demand for the band, Western Bred would perform at many other venues as well. Rodeo's, concerts, corporate parties, dances, etc. This busy performance schedule would cast the band in front of thousands of country music fans each year and helped earn Western Bred the title "Arizona's Best Country Band" (Arizona Republic).
Western Bred, deep rooted in Arizona country music and southwestern culture, this seasoned band continues to share great music and fun with folks everywhere.
